Do I have to sign a contract?
We have an Open Door policy, so you’re not locked in – you can start and stop whenever you like.
Do I have to pre-pay?
We operate on a Pay-As-You-Go basis – you only pay for the time you use.
Is there a set term?
Our Open Door policy means you can start and stop whenever you like – there is no minimum or maximum.
Do you only work online?
You can choose the type of service that suits your needs best – you can also mix them if you like.
We offer:
- Email only
- Phone and SMS
- Group consultations and master classes
- Personalised one-on-one coaching
